Scene

IV

Another part of the field.

Excursions. Enter Richard and Clifford.

Richard

Now, Clifford, I have singled thee alone:

Suppose this arm is for the Duke of York,

And this for Rutland; both bound to revenge,

Wert thou environ’d with a brazen wall.

Clifford

Now, Richard, I am with thee here alone:

This is the hand that stabb’d thy father York;

And this the hand that slew thy brother Rutland;

And here’s the heart that triumphs in their death

And cheers these hands that slew thy sire and brother

To execute the like upon thyself;

And so, have at thee! They fight. Warwick comes; Clifford flies.

Richard

Nay Warwick, single out some other chase;

For I myself will hunt this wolf to death. Exeunt.
